Supportive Housing combines affordable housing, most often … tammy beardsleyWebSep 26, 2024 · Affordable housing models include Permanent Supportive Housing (PSH), Housing First, and recovery housing. PSH is community-based housing targeted to extremely low-income households with serious and long-term disabilities.
